The curse of poverty
History is witness that the Sindhi people have never been so much poor as they have become nowadays. Reason is simple behind this abject poverty in Sindh province is simple because their so-called elected representatives- MNAs and MPAs- and also bureaucrats and technocrats are rich. They are entirely corrupt and embezzle and misappropriate the funds. It would be nice if the poor were to get even half of the money that is spent over publicity and advertisement of Sindh Bank and other organizations in the province.
Confucius has aptly said: “In a country well governed, poverty is something to be ashamed of. In a country badly governed, wealth is something to be ashamed of.” Is there anyone to take notice of the sordid state of affairs in the province and direct the thick-skinned provincial rulers and also Pakistan Poverty Alleviation Fund ( PPAF) and Sindh Rural Support Program, which have done nothing practical to lessen poverty.
